H. Wayne Orange, 75, of Troutville, went to be with the Lord on Saturday, May 2, 2015. He was born on March 28, 1940 in Troutville, Va. Wayne was preceded in death by his parents, Hubert J. and Mary Bishop Orange; brother, Archie Orange; brothers-in-law, George Kent and Roy Thompson, Sr. Surviving are his loving wife of 56 years, Barbara Thompson Orange; devoted son, David and daughter-in-law, Kim Orange; two precious grandchildren, Bryan and Jessie Orange and their mother, Lynda Orange. His loving sister, Doris Kent; sisters-in-law, Ruby Orange, Mary Green, and Evelyn Gill; brother-in-law, Elmer Gill; along with many nieces, nephews, aunts, cousins, church family and friends. Wayne loved antique Fords, and raising goats and donkeys. He also enjoyed working on motorcycles and mopeds while working at Jimbo's Motorcycle in Cloverdale. He was a member of Gospel Light Baptist church where his service will be held on Wednesday, May 6, 2015 at 2:00 pm with Dr. M. Brian Swafford and Rev. Earl Clemons officiating. Interment will follow in Daleville Cemetery.
